HANS Device Offers IHRA Contingency Sponsorship
ATLANTA, Feb. 16 /PRNewswire/ -- HANS Performance Products joins IHRA's contingency sponsorship program for 2007. The HANS Device program covers IHRA National Pro classes. Winners in Top Fuel, Pro Modified, Funny Car Alcohol, Funny Car Nitro, and Pro Stock can claim $500 cash awards. Runners up qualify for $100.Mark Stiles, HANS Performance Products' CEO, commented, "IHRA has been very responsible in mandating head and neck restraints in Pro classes for 2007. By far, HANS Devices lead the industry in performance, and this program gives us a direct way of supporting the foremost IHRA competitors as they respond to the need for increased safety measures."
Mark added, "New recruit Jeff Garvin brings tremendous industry experience to our team. He is focused entirely on programs to help our dealers better understand the needs of their drag racing customers. Jeff will also provide racers with specialty support at the strip throughout the year."
HANS Devices are available throughout North America via a network of over 150 dealers. South Carolina based Factory Trained dealer Vickery's Speed Shop will be in the midway at most IHRA National events to provide specialty sales and support.
